Green Run strolled into their game on Friday with a perfect record and they left with the same. They walked away with a 28-17 win over the Kempsville Chiefs. Given the Stallions' advantage in MaxPreps' Virginia football rankings (they are ranked 32nd, while the Chiefs are ranked 99th) , the result wasn't entirely unexpected.
Despite the loss, Kempsville still got an impressive performance from Camir Croom, who picked up 182 receiving yards and one score.
Green Run's victory bumped their record up to 5-0. As for Kempsville, they suffered their first home defeat, dropping their record down to 2-2.
We've got plenty of inter-region action coming up soon. Green Run is set to square off against their familiar foe Salem at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. Meanwhile, Kempsville will challenge rival Landstown at 7:00 p.m. on Friday.
